Ancestry & Birthplace in Moama

Where people and their families come from — the ancestries they identify with and where they were born.

Only 8% of people in Moama were born overseas, a figure far below the New South Wales and national averages. This makes the area one of the least diverse in the region in terms of birthplace. Most residents claim English or Australian ancestry.

Ancestry

The ancestries people most identify with.

English and Australian ancestries are most common, accounting for 43.3% and 42% of the population respectively. Irish and Scottish roots follow at 11.8% and 11.4%.

Country of birth

Australia and the largest overseas communities.

While the proportion of overseas-born residents rose slightly from 6.9% in 2011 to 8% in 2021, this remains far below the state figure of 29.3%. Most people here were born in Australia (84.9%), followed by England at 2.5%.
